Encapsulation of the UV-DNA repair enzyme T4 endonuclease V in liposomes and delivery to human cells.

J Ceccoli1, N Rosales, J Tsimis, D B Yarosh.   

Abstract

T4 endonuclease V, a pyrimidine-dimer-specific DNA repair enzyme, was encapsulated in liposomes under mild conditions. The encapsulated enzyme was active, and when applied to ultraviolet (UV)-irradiated human cells in culture, the liposomes increased incision of UV-irradiated cellular DNA, enhanced DNA repair replication, and enhanced survival of UV-irradiated cells. This method is a first step in a new approach for topical application of DNA repair enzymes to human skin to prevent skin cancer.
